7.1.9 mtracert

Syntax
mtracert source-address [ group-address | last-hop-router-address group-address ]
View
Any view
Parameter
source-address: Multicast source address
group-address: Multicast group address

Description
Up time of the (S, G, RP) entry in SA cache of
the local router, in minutes. The maximum value
is 255.
An (S, G, RP) entry exists in the SA cache of the
local router, but the RP is different from the RP
specified in the request message.
The local router is an RP, but it may be another
RP than the source RP in the (S, G, RP) entry.
SA cache is enabled on the local router.
A (S, G, RP) entry exists in SA cache of the local
router.
Maximum number of hops is reached. Another
possible value is:
Hit-src-RP: The router of this hop is the source
RP in the (S, G, RP) entry.
If you use the next-hop-info keyword, the
address of Peer-RPF neighbor is displayed.
The number of SA messages received to trace
the (S, G, RP) entry.
The number of packets received to trace the (S,
G, RP) entry.
The up time of an SA cache entry
The expiry time of an SA cache entry
The time of the peering session between the
local router and a Peer-PRF neighbor
Count of session resets
